They came to a high-end French restaurant. The lights were low and strategically placed. The floor incorporated a white and black checkered design; the walls were dark gray, covered in vintage art, and the tables were small and white. The chairs were made of wood and wicker, alternating between plain and black. The tables were made for couples to be closer to each other.
While looking at the loving couples in the restaurant, Anne felt that this was the most unlikely spot for her and Kevin to eat.
People who came here were usually the closest lovers, and the two of them did not fit that description at all.
"I think we'd better find another restaurant," Anne said. "This really isn't us." She looked at Kevin to gauge his reaction.
He frowned and looked at her unhappily, inexplicable anger shone in his black eyes.
"Why not? What's wrong with this place?"
Kevin knew what she was thinking, and that was why he was even less happy.
"Take a look around. See that couple? And that one? Everyone here is very much in love. Don't you think it's kind of ironic for us to grab a meal here?"
Anne couldn't accept the fact that she was having lunch with Kevin in a warm and romantic setting like this one.
"Not really. A man and his wife should be fine eating here." The more this woman wanted to escape, the more he wanted to stay here for lunch.
"You know our marriage is a sham, right? It's a contractual agreement. You're the one that keeps reminding me."
Her words were still calm. She felt a sense of relief when she thought of it. Their relationship would be over the moment the baby was born.
"Even if it is a contract, you're still my wife. I don't want to hear you bring that up again!"
Kevin reminded Anne coldly as he dragged her to a seat.
The two of them sat face to face, and their expressions were passionless. Anne looked away.
"Mr. Kevin, we haven't seen you in forever!" The manager of the restaurant came to greet Kevin as soon as he found his VIP.
Kevin's face softened. He looked at the restaurant manager and replied indifferently,
"I've been busy. And that gives me a healthy appetite."
"Right. You must be very busy since you have such a big company to manage. Who is your guest? You usually come here with Miss Cherry."
Although Kevin looked indifferent, the restaurant manager was quite enthusiastic.
When she heard Cherry's name, Anne frowned. A flash of disgust flashed through her beautiful eyes, and she felt a little bitter in her heart. So he'd been to this restaurant before—and he'd brought Cherry along.
